'No winners in tariffs wars or trade wars': Xi Jinping makes first public remarks after tariff rollback
Chinese President Xi Jinping made first public comments since the US and China reached a trade truce. "Bullying or hegemonism only leads to self-isolation," Xi told the audience at a summit with Latin American and Caribbean officials in Beijing on Tuesday.
